Two classes, same average
Two classes both average 75 on a test. But Class A scored 73, 74, 75, 76, 77 — tight as a drum. Class B scored 40, 60, 75, 90, 110 — all over the map. The mean alone calls them identical; the spread tells the truth. A center without a spread is half a description. You need to know how scattered the data is, and the first spread you'll meet is the range — and its stronger cousin, the IQR.
